What factors must be considered when interpolating fuel consumption rates?

When interpolating fuel consumption rates, the factors of weight, altitude, and airspeed are crucial.

Weight directly affects fuel burn; a heavier aircraft requires more power to climb and maintain cruising speed, leading to increased fuel consumption. Altitude comes into play since engine performance and atmospheric conditions change with altitude. Typically, engines may consume less fuel at higher altitudes due to thinner air, but this can also depend on the specific engine characteristics and operational profile. Airspeed affects drag and overall engine efficiency; flying at optimal airspeeds can lead to reduced fuel consumption, whereas flying too fast or too slow can increase drag and fuel requirements.

Combining these factors allows for a more accurate estimation of fuel consumption under varying conditions, which is critical for flight planning and operational efficiency.
